I Description:
Rubber coupling also known as flexible rubber joint, rubber flexible connectors, Rubber flexible joints, pipeline shock absorber, etc.
II Classification:
1)According to appearance: Concentric with diameter rubber joint, concentric reducer rubber joint, eccentric reducer rubber joint.
2) According to the structure: Single Sphere Flexible Rubber Joint, Double Sphere Rubber Joint, Spheres Rubber Joint, and Elbow Sphere Rubber Joint
3) According to link form: Flange Coupling, Threaded Joint
III Characteristic Feature:
1) Small volume, light in weight, very good flexibility, convenient installation and maintenance
2) Transverse displacement, axial displacement, angular displacement
3) Reduce noise, shock absorption
IV Range of Application:
Due to favorable integrated performance, they can be widely used in chemical industry, construction, water supply, drainage, oil industry, light and heavy industry, refrigeration station, water heating system, fire fighting system, electric power system, etc.
V Application Medium:
According to different material, acid resistance rubber joint, alkali proof rubber joint, oil resistance, rubber joint, thermostability rubber joint, low temperature resistance rubber joint, wear resistance rubber joint can be made to suitable for various kinds of medium, and environment.

| VI. Material List | ||||||||||||||||
| No. | Name | Material | ||||||||||||||
| 1) | Inner rubber | IIR, CR, EPDM, NR, NBR | ||||||||||||||
| 2) | Outer rubber | IIR, CR, EPDM, NR, NBR | ||||||||||||||
| 3) | Framework layer | Polyester cord fabric | ||||||||||||||
| 4) | Flange | Q235 | ||||||||||||||
| 5) | Reinforcing ring | Steel wire rope | ||||||||||||||
